Bitcoin, the world’s first decentralized digital currency, has undergone several forks throughout its existence. Forking occurs when the underlying code of a blockchain network is modified, resulting in the establishment of a new version of the cryptocurrency. These forks can be categorized into two types – hard forks and soft forks. Understanding the differences between these forks is crucial in comprehending the impact they have on the Bitcoin network.
A hard fork refers to a permanent and radical change in the Bitcoin protocol. It involves a complete divergence from the previous version of the blockchain, resulting in the creation of a new blockchain with its own set of rules. Hard forks often result from conflicts within the community regarding changes to the network’s protocol. Examples of well-known hard forks include Bitcoin Cash and Bitcoin SV.
In contrast, a soft fork is a backward-compatible upgrade to the Bitcoin protocol. It involves making changes to the existing code in a way that does not require all participants to upgrade their software. Instead, soft forks are designed to be compatible with older versions of the software, with the intention of gaining widespread consensus among network participants. Notable soft forks in Bitcoin’s history include Segregated Witness (SegWit) and the taproot upgrade.
It is essential to note that forks can lead to the creation of new cryptocurrencies and can have a significant impact on the overall market. Forks often result in increased volatility and uncertainty, as users and investors assess the viability and potential benefits of the new version of the cryptocurrency. Therefore, staying informed about upcoming forks and understanding their implications is crucial for anyone involved in the Bitcoin ecosystem.
What is a Bitcoin Fork and When Does It Happen?
When a fork happens, a new version of the Bitcoin software is introduced, and it becomes incompatible with the existing version. As a result, a new blockchain is formed, and the original blockchain continues to run alongside it.
Forks can be either hard forks or soft forks. A hard fork involves a significant change in the rules, and it is not backwards-compatible with the old version. On the other hand, a soft fork introduces a compatible change, and both the old and new versions can coexist.
The main reason for a fork is usually a difference in opinion on how the Bitcoin network should operate. It can be related to issues such as scalability, block size, or consensus mechanisms. Forks can also occur due to security vulnerabilities or attempts to reverse transactions.
There have been several notable Bitcoin forks in the past, including Bitcoin Cash, Bitcoin SV, and Bitcoin Gold. These forks resulted in the creation of new cryptocurrencies that share a common history with Bitcoin but have their own distinct characteristics.
Forks typically occur when there is a lack of consensus among the network participants. This can happen due to disagreements between developers, miners, and other stakeholders. The decision to fork is often made through a community-driven process, with participants expressing their support for one version or the other.
Overall, forks are an essential part of the evolution of the Bitcoin network. While they can lead to temporary confusion and uncertainty, they also allow for innovation and experimentation. By branching off into new versions, Bitcoin forks contribute to the development of the cryptocurrency ecosystem as a whole.
Understanding Bitcoin Forks
Bitcoin forks are events that occur when the blockchain protocol of Bitcoin is changed, resulting in two separate versions of the original cryptocurrency. These forks can happen due to various reasons, such as disagreements among the community or the need to implement new features or improvements.
There are two main types of forks: soft forks and hard forks. Soft forks are backward-compatible, meaning that the older version of the protocol can still recognize and validate the new blocks. On the other hand, hard forks are not backward-compatible, and the new version of the protocol is not recognized by the older version. This results in a split in the blockchain, creating two separate chains and two separate cryptocurrencies.
Bitcoin forks can be planned or unplanned. Planned forks are typically announced in advance, allowing users and developers to prepare for the changes. Unplanned forks, on the other hand, occur spontaneously when a significant number of miners and nodes adopt a new version of the protocol without prior coordination.
Some popular Bitcoin forks include Bitcoin Cash, Bitcoin Gold, and Bitcoin SV. These forks were created with the goal of addressing certain limitations of the original Bitcoin protocol, such as scalability or mining centralization.
-
Bitcoin Cash (BCH): Created in 2017, Bitcoin Cash increased the block size limit to 8MB, allowing for faster and cheaper transactions compared to Bitcoin.
-
Bitcoin Gold (BTG): Launched in 2017, Bitcoin Gold aimed to make mining more accessible to individual miners by changing the consensus algorithm from Proof of Work to Proof of Stake.
-
Bitcoin SV (BSV): Created in 2018, Bitcoin SV aimed to restore the original Bitcoin protocol and increase the block size limit to 128MB.
It’s important to note that each Bitcoin fork creates a new cryptocurrency with its own market value and community. Users holding Bitcoin prior to a fork typically receive an equal amount of the new cryptocurrency, allowing them to participate in both chains if they choose to do so.
In conclusion, Bitcoin forks are significant events in the cryptocurrency ecosystem that result in the creation of new cryptocurrencies with different features or improvements. These forks can be planned or unplanned and can address various limitations of the original Bitcoin protocol.
Types of Bitcoin Forks
Bitcoin has undergone several forks throughout its history, resulting in the creation of new cryptocurrencies. These forks can be categorized into different types based on their underlying motivations and the changes they introduce to the Bitcoin network.
Soft Forks
A soft fork is a type of fork that introduces backward-compatible changes to the Bitcoin protocol. This means that these changes do not require all users to upgrade their software in order to continue participating in the network. Soft forks typically implement improvements or enhancements to the existing system without fundamentally changing its core principles.
Example: The Segregated Witness (SegWit) soft fork implemented a change to Bitcoin’s block size limit by segregating the transaction signature data from the main transaction block.
Hard Forks
A hard fork, on the other hand, introduces changes to the Bitcoin protocol that are not backward-compatible. This means that all users must upgrade their software in order to continue using the network. Hard forks often result in the creation of a new cryptocurrency that operates on a separate blockchain, while the original Bitcoin continues to operate on its existing chain.
Example: The Bitcoin Cash hard fork increased the block size limit from 1 MB to 8 MB, enabling faster transaction processing and scalability compared to the original Bitcoin.
Within the category of hard forks, there can be further distinctions based on the level of community consensus and support for the new blockchain:
- Planned Hard Forks: These forks are pre-announced and coordinated by the community, with broad consensus and support.
- Contentious Hard Forks: These forks occur when there is disagreement within the community about the proposed changes, leading to a split in the network and the creation of competing chains.
User-Activated Forks (UAF)
A user-activated fork is a type of hard fork initiated by a specific group of Bitcoin users who are dissatisfied with the existing protocol and wish to implement their own set of changes. UAFs do not require majority consensus from the overall Bitcoin community but aim to create a new cryptocurrency with modified rules and features.
Example: The Bitcoin Gold user-activated fork aimed to democratize Bitcoin mining by replacing the existing mining algorithm with a different one, making it more accessible to individual miners.
In conclusion, Bitcoin forks occur for various reasons and can result in the creation of new cryptocurrencies with different rule sets and features. Whether they are soft forks, hard forks, or user-activated forks, these events shape the evolution of the cryptocurrency ecosystem and offer alternatives to the original Bitcoin network.
Factors Affecting Bitcoin Forks
Bitcoin forks, the process by which a new cryptocurrency is created as a result of changes made to the original Bitcoin code, can occur for various reasons. Several factors influence the decision to fork Bitcoin, including:
1. Scaling and Transaction Speed: One of the primary factors behind Bitcoin forks is the scalability issue. As the number of Bitcoin users and transactions grows, the network can become congested, leading to delays and higher fees. Forks are often initiated to propose solutions that can increase the transaction speed and capacity of the blockchain.
2. Governance and Consensus: Disagreements among the Bitcoin community regarding the direction of the cryptocurrency can also trigger forks. Different factions may have varying visions for Bitcoin’s future, including changes to the protocol, block size, or mining algorithms. Forks allow these factions to implement their preferred changes and create a separate cryptocurrency with its own governance model.
3. Security and Privacy: Security vulnerabilities discovered in Bitcoin’s code or concerns about user privacy can also lead to forks. If a significant flaw or risk is identified, some may choose to fork Bitcoin to address these issues and provide a more secure or private alternative.
4. Ideological Differences: Bitcoin is often associated with certain ideological beliefs, such as decentralization, individual freedom, or opposition to centralized control. Disputes related to these ideologies can prompt forks as different groups seek to align Bitcoin more closely with their values or principles.
5. Community Support: Ultimately, the success of a forked cryptocurrency depends on the level of community support it receives. If a significant number of users, developers, and miners back the fork, it has a higher chance of establishing itself as a viable alternative to Bitcoin.
While these factors can spark Bitcoin forks, it is important to note that not all proposed forks result in successful new cryptocurrencies. Forks require widespread support and acceptance to gain traction in the market and compete with Bitcoin’s established network effects.
Predicting Bitcoin Forks
Bitcoin forks, or splits in the Bitcoin blockchain, can occur for various reasons. Whether it’s due to disagreements within the community, software updates, or scalability issues, predicting when a Bitcoin fork will happen can be challenging. However, there are several indicators and factors that can provide insight into potential fork events.
Firstly, monitoring online communities and forums dedicated to Bitcoin can be helpful. These platforms often have discussions about possible forks, with users expressing their opinions and proposing potential solutions. By keeping an eye on these communities, one can gain an understanding of the sentiment and likelihood of a fork occurring.
Secondly, analyzing the developments and progress of Bitcoin’s software can provide valuable information. The Bitcoin Core software, which powers the main Bitcoin network, undergoes updates and improvements over time. By keeping up to date with these developments, one can identify any potential changes that may lead to a fork.
Furthermore, paying attention to the market sentiment and investor behavior can indicate the possibility of a fork. For example, if there are significant disagreements or debates within the community, this can create uncertainty and volatility in the market. Traders and investors may adjust their positions in anticipation of a potential fork, leading to price fluctuations.
Additionally, tracking the network’s hash rate and mining activity can be insightful. Miners play a crucial role in the Bitcoin ecosystem, and their support is necessary for a fork to occur. A sudden increase or decrease in mining activity may indicate that miners are preparing for a fork or rejecting the idea.
Lastly, keeping an eye on major events and milestones within the cryptocurrency industry can provide clues about potential forks. For example, regulatory changes, technological advancements, or major partnerships can impact the Bitcoin community and potentially lead to a fork.
In conclusion, predicting Bitcoin forks is a complex task that requires monitoring various indicators and factors. By staying informed about online communities, software developments, market sentiment, mining activity, and industry events, one can increase their chances of anticipating a Bitcoin fork.